Three chief customer officer job descriptions we love

ChurnZero

The role of the chief customer officer has become an essential function in subscription-based business models such as software-as-a-service (SaaS), where customer retention is paramount and requires executive-level leadership. If a customer churns before the payback period is met, it’s a financial net loss.
